Two-color mustard minced pork roll

Ingredients
- Chicken Essence 1 tsp
- Minced Pork 30g
- Oyster sauce 15g
- Pickled mustard 25g
- Purple sweet potato puree 200g
- Thirteen incense 1 tsp
- Warm water 110 grams (according to the water content of purple sweet potato and the water absorption of flour)
- Yeast 4 grams (2 grams for white dough, 2 grams for purple potato dough)
- plain flour 400g (200g for white dough, 200g for purple potato dough)
- salt 1 tsp
- salt and pepper 1 tsp
- vegetable oil 15g
Steps

Mix 200 grams of flour and 2 grams of yeast powder, add purple sweet potato puree, knead with your hands while adding, add 10 grams of warm water, and knead into a smooth purple sweet potato dough.

Mix 200 grams of flour and 2 grams of yeast powder, slowly add 100 grams of warm water, stir with chopsticks while adding, and knead into a smooth white dough.

After the two colors of dough are kneaded, cover with a lid or plastic wrap and leave to ferment in a warm place until doubled in size.

Dip your index finger in flour and poke a hole in the middle. If the hole does not collapse or shrink back, or you can see that the inside of the dough has formed a honeycomb shape, it is ready to ferment.

Knead the fermented dough until the surface is smooth.

Roll out the white dough into a large piece and brush with vegetable oil.

Roll out the purple sweet potato dough into a large piece, spread it on the white dough sheet, brush it with a layer of oyster sauce, sprinkle some salt, thirteen spices, salt and pepper, chicken essence, spread an appropriate amount of mustard and minced meat, and roll it up.

Press the joint underneath and cut into small pieces.

Stack the two sections together and press the middle with chopsticks to the bottom.

Fold both sides in half.

Put it in a steamer covered with a drawer cloth, leaving a gap in the middle, because it will grow bigger when steaming. Let it rise for a second time for 20 minutes (adjust the rising time according to the temperature) until it doubles in size.

Bring the water to a boil over high heat, steam over medium heat for about 15 minutes, turn off the heat, and then uncover the pot after simmering for 5 minutes.
